One of the most renowned boarding schools in England is Eton College, located in Berkshire Founded in 1440 by King Henry VI, Eton College has a rich history and an outstanding academic reputation With a focus on academic excellence, as well as extracurricular activities and personal development, Eton College provides its students with a well-rounded education that prepares them for success in the future.

Another top boarding school in England is Harrow School, located in London With its impressive list of alumni, including Winston Churchill and Benedict Cumberbatch, Harrow School is known for its high academic standards and excellence in sports and the arts The school’s motto, “Stet Fortuna Domus,” which means “Let the Fortune of the House Stand,” reflects its commitment to providing a supportive and nurturing environment for its students.

Rugby School, located in Warwickshire, is another esteemed boarding school in England Founded in 1567, Rugby School is one of the oldest boarding schools in the country The school’s emphasis on holistic education, which includes academics, sports, and the arts, sets it apart from other boarding schools With state-of-the-art facilities and a strong sense of community, Rugby School provides its students with a well-rounded educational experience.

Another top boarding school in England is Winchester College, located in Hampshire Founded in 1382, Winchester College is one of the oldest boarding schools in the country The school’s rigorous academic program, as well as its emphasis on character development and service to others, prepares its students for success in a rapidly changing world With its historic buildings and beautiful campus, Winchester College provides a unique and inspiring learning environment for its students.

For those looking for a more modern approach to education, Bedales School in Hampshire is an excellent choice Founded in 1893, Bedales School is known for its progressive educational philosophy, which emphasizes creativity, individuality, and collaboration With its innovative curriculum and emphasis on the arts and outdoor education, Bedales School provides its students with a unique and enriching educational experience.

Hurtwood House, located in Surrey, is another top boarding school in England known for its excellence in the arts Founded in 1970, Hurtwood House offers a creative and nurturing environment for students who are passionate about the arts With its state-of-the-art facilities and dedicated faculty, Hurtwood House provides its students with the tools and support they need to pursue their artistic ambitions.
